Zachariah Olumide Ebunoluwa Awe (born 9 January 2004) is a professional footballer who plays as a defender for {{English football updater|Southamp}} club Southampton. He is an England youth international.{{cite web|title=Zach Awe|website=Soccerway|date=9 August 2023|url=https://uk.soccerway.com/players/zach-awe/629200/}}
Club career
Awe spent eleven years in the youth ranks at Arsenal.{{cite web|url=https://www.hampshirelive.news/sport/football/transfer-news/zach-awe-southampton-transfer-arsenal-8662365.amp|website=Hampshire Live|accessdate=9 August 2023|title= Zach Awe's first words as Southampton complete transfer for Arsenal centre-back|date=8 August 2023|first=Mark|last=Wyatt}} He made appearances in the EFL Trophy for Arsenal, and was included in match-day squads for the first team, and was an unused substitute in the Premier League without making a first team debut.{{Cite web |last=Begley |first=Emlyn |date=10 February 2022 |title=Wolverhampton Wanderers 0–1 Arsenal |url=https://www.bbc.co.uk/sport/football/60239159 |access-date=9 August 2023 |website=BBC Sport}} He joined Southampton in August 2023, despite being offered new terms by his hometown club, signing a three-year contract, initially joining the Under-21's for the 2023–24 season.{{cite web|url=https://www.dailyecho.co.uk/sport/23691085.amp/|website=Daily Echo|accessdate=9 August 2023|date=8 August 2023|title= Southampton complete signing of promising former Arsenal defender|first=Alfie|last=House}}{{cite web|url= https://www.nytimes.com/athletic/4731095/2023/07/29/arsenal-zach-awe-southampton/|website=The Athletic|access-date=9 August 2023|title= Former Arsenal defender Zach Awe to join Southampton|first=Jordan|last=Campbell|date=29 July 2023}}{{Cite web |date=8 August 2023 |title=Saints confirm Zach Awe signing |url=https://www.southamptonfc.com/en/news/article/saints-confirm-zach-awe-signing |access-date=9 August 2023 |website=Southampton FC}}
On 4 July 2024, Awe joined League Two club Accrington Stanley on a season-long loan.{{Cite web |date=4 July 2024 |title=Zach Awe joins Accrington on loan |url=https://www.southamptonfc.com/en/news/article/zach-awe-joins-accrington-on-loan |access-date=4 July 2024 |website=Southampton FC}} He made his debut for the club on 10 August 2024 in a 4–1 defeat against Doncaster Rovers.{{Cite web |date=10 August 2024 |title=Doncaster Rovers 4–1 Accrington Stanley |url=https://www.bbc.co.uk/sport/football/live/cx2ele9rxg0t |access-date=10 August 2024 |website=BBC Sport}} On 8 October 2024, Awe received a red card during a 2–1 defeat against Tranmere Rovers in the EFL Trophy.{{Cite web |date=8 October 2024 |title=Tranmere Rovers 2–1 Accrington Stanley |url=https://www.bbc.co.uk/sport/football/live/c0lw9k62gnnt?page=3 |access-date=12 October 2024 |website=BBC Sport}}{{Cite web |title=REPORT: Tranmere Rovers 2 Stanley 1 |url=https://www.accringtonstanley.co.uk/news/2024/october/08/report-tranmere-rovers-v-stanley/ |access-date=12 October 2024 |website=Accrington Stanley FC}} He scored his first goal for the club on 9 November 2024 in a 3–0 away victory against Chesterfield.{{Cite web |date=9 November 2024 |title=Chesterfield 0–3 Accrington Stanley |url=https://www.bbc.co.uk/sport/football/live/c74lzl4732vt |access-date=11 November 2024 |website=BBC Sport}} On 3 February 2025, Awe was recalled from loan and returned to Southampton after he suffered an injury in January.{{Cite web |date=3 February 2025 |title=O'Brien-Whitmarsh joins Accrington on loan as Awe recalled |url=https://www.southamptonfc.com/en/news/article/obrien-whitmarsh-joins-accrington-on-loan-as-awe-recalled |access-date=3 February 2025 |website=Southampton FC}}
International career
Awe made his debut playing for the England U-16 side in August 2019.{{cite web|url=https://uk.soccerway.com/matches/2019/08/18/world/under-16-friendlies/england-u16/denmark-u16/3370659/|website=Soccerway|accessdate=9 August 2023|title= ENGLAND U16 VS. DENMARK U16 2 - 0|date=18 August 2019}} In September 2023 he was called up to the England U-20 side.{{cite web|website=Daily Echo|accessdate=6 September 2023|first=George|last=Rees-Julian|date=5 September 2023|title=Southampton defender receives late call up to England youth team squad|url=https://www.dailyecho.co.uk/sport/23768206.southampton-defender-receives-late-call-england-youth-team-squad/}}
Style of play
He has been described as a ball-playing central defender, comfortable with the ball at his feet and capable of playing out from the back.{{cite web|url=https://www.leicestermercury.co.uk/sport/football/transfer-news/arsenal-contract-rebel-discussed-leicester-8556365.amp|website=Leicester Mercury|accessdate=9 August 2023|date=27 June 2023|first=Luke|last=Rawley|title= Arsenal contract rebel 'discussed' by Leicester City as free transfer looms}}
Personal life
Born in Greenwich, London,{{cite web|url=https://www.arsenal.com/historic/players/zach-awe|website=Arsenal.com|accessdate=9 August 2023|title=Zach Awe}} he has Nigerian and St Lucian heritage.{{cite web|url=https://thestreetjournal.org/who-is-zach-awe-18-year-old-nigerian-defender-who-made-arsenals-bench-against-wolves/|date=February 11, 2022|title=Who is Zach Awe? 18 Year Old Nigerian Defender Who Made Arsenal's Bench Against Wolves |website=thestreetjournal.org|accessdate=9 August 2023}}{{cite web|url=https://www.allnigeriasoccer.com/read_news.php?nid=48393|website=allnigeriasoccer.com|accessdate=9 August 2023|title= Official: Flying Eagles-eligible CB joins Southampton after release by Arsenal |date=8 August 2023}}
